Responsibilities

The In-Plant Safety Specialist identifies and eliminates hazards in the workplace by ensuring compliance with our safety procedures in the plant. The individual in this position must know, understand, and be able to communicate our safety policies and practices to team members, and train and re-train team members on proper safety practices. Job duties include:

  • Ensure team members comply with all company policies and procedures and customer requirements.
  • Implement and maintain safety policies and procedures.
  • Follow Site Management, Area Management, Division Managements, VP, and Technical Services directives regarding issues related to Safety, Health, and Environmental.
  • Maintain regular communication with Site Manager, Safety, and Technical Services team.
  • Report all accidents and first aid following established accident and first aid reporting SOP, including reporting caught-in type accidents following established protocol.
  • Perform investigations at the plant level as needed including severe injuries, OSHA complaints, and when necessary to assist other departments.
  • Ensure all investigations are followed up and an action plan is implemented successfully.
  • Perform weekly safety audits, assist operations with corrective actions, and report findings by email to appropriate management.
  • Exercise independent judgement and issue disciplinary action or terminate team members for safety violations.
  • Complete the In-Plant Safety Specialist on the job training including regularly scheduled and completed safety training, making improvements to safety awareness, training consistency, safety performance metrics, and knowledge of management and team members.
  • Other duties as assigned.
